| CVE | Vendors | Products | Updated | CVSS v3.1 |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| CVE-2021-44854 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-14 | 5.3 Medium |
| An issue was discovered in MediaWiki before 1.35.5, 1.36.x before 1.36.3, and 1.37.x before 1.37.1. The REST API publicly caches results from private wikis. | ||||
| CVE-2022-41767 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-14 | 5.3 Medium |
| An issue was discovered in MediaWiki before 1.35.8, 1.36.x and 1.37.x before 1.37.5, and 1.38.x before 1.38.3. When changes made by an IP address are reassigned to a user (using reassignEdits.php), the changes will still be attributed to the IP address on Special:Contributions when doing a range lookup. | ||||
| CVE-2022-41765 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-14 | 5.3 Medium |
| An issue was discovered in MediaWiki before 1.35.8, 1.36.x and 1.37.x before 1.37.5, and 1.38.x before 1.38.3. HTMLUserTextField exposes the existence of hidden users. | ||||
| CVE-2015-2941 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in MediaWiki before 1.19.24, 1.2x before 1.23.9, and 1.24.x before 1.24.2, when using HHVM, all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via an invalid parameter in a wddx format request to api.php, which is not properly handled in an error message, related to unsafe calls to wddx_serialize_value. | ||||
| CVE-2015-2942 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| MediaWiki before 1.19.24, 1.2x before 1.23.9, and 1.24.x before 1.24.2, when using HHVM,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(CPU and memory consumption) via a large number of nested entity references in an (1) SVG file or (2) XMP metadata in a PDF file, aka a "billion laughs attack," a different vulnerability than CVE-2015-2937. | ||||
| CVE-2015-2939 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Scribunto |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in the Scribunto extension for MediaWiki all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via a function name, which is not properly handled in a Lua error backtrace. | ||||
| CVE-2015-2938 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in MediaWiki before 1.19.24, 1.2x before 1.23.9, and 1.24.x before 1.24.2 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via a custom JavaScript file, which is not properly handled when previewing the file. | ||||
| CVE-2014-7199 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in MediaWiki before 1.19.19, 1.22.x before 1.22.11, and 1.23.x before 1.23.4 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via a crafted SVG file. | ||||
| CVE-2015-2935 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| MediaWiki before 1.19.24, 1.2x before 1.23.9, and 1.24.x before 1.24.2 allows remote attackers to bypass the SVG filtering and obtain sensitive user information via a mixed case @import in a style element in an SVG file, as demonstrated by "@imporT." | ||||
| CVE-2015-6733 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| GeSHi, as used in the SyntaxHighlight_GeSHi extension and MediaWiki before 1.23.10, 1.24.x before 1.24.3, and 1.25.x before 1.25.2,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(resource consumption) via unspecified vectors. | ||||
| CVE-2014-3966 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in Special:PasswordReset in MediaWiki before 1.19.16, 1.21.x before 1.21.10, and 1.22.x before 1.22.7, when wgRawHtml is enabled, all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via an invalid username. | ||||
| CVE-2014-9277 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| The wfMangleFlashPolicy function in OutputHandler.php in MediaWiki before 1.19.22, 1.20.x through 1.22.x before 1.22.14, and 1.23.x before 1.23.7 allows remote attackers to conduct PHP object injection attacks via a crafted string containing <cross-domain-policy> in a PHP format request, which causes the string length to change when converting the request to <NOT-cross-domain-policy>. | ||||
| CVE-2012-5395 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Session fixation vulnerability in the CentralAuth extension for MediaWiki before 1.18.6, 1.19.x before 1.19.3, and 1.20.x before 1.20.1 allows remote attackers to hijack web sessions via the centralauth_Session cookie. | ||||
| CVE-2012-5391 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Session fixation vulnerability in Special:UserLogin in MediaWiki before 1.18.6, 1.19.x before 1.19.3, and 1.20.x before 1.20.1 allows remote attackers to hijack web sessions via the session_id. | ||||
| CVE-2013-6453 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| MediaWiki before 1.19.10, 1.2x before 1.21.4, and 1.22.x before 1.22.1 does not properly sanitize SVG files, which allows remote attackers to have unspecified impact via invalid XML. | ||||
| CVE-2015-2937 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| MediaWiki before 1.19.24, 1.2x before 1.23.9, and 1.24.x before 1.24.2, when using HHVM or Zend PHP,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service ("quadratic blowup" and memory consumption) via an XML file containing an entity declaration with long replacement text and many references to this entity, a different vulnerability than CVE-2015-2942. | ||||
| CVE-2014-9480 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in the Hovercards extension for MediaWiki all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via vectors related to text extracts. | ||||
| CVE-2015-2934 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| MediaWiki before 1.19.24, 1.2x before 1.23.9, and 1.24.x before 1.24.2 does not properly handle when the Zend interpreter xml_parse function does not expand entities, which all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via a crafted SVG file. | ||||
| CVE-2015-6727 | 2 Canonical, Mediawiki | 2 Ubuntu Linux, Mediawiki |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| The Special:DeletedContributions page in MediaWiki before 1.23.10, 1.24.x before 1.24.3, and 1.25.x before 1.25.2 allows remote attackers to determine if an IP is autoblocked via the "Change block" text. | ||||
| CVE-2014-2665 | 1 Mediawiki | 1 Mediawiki |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| includes/specials/SpecialChangePassword.php in MediaWiki before 1.19.14, 1.20.x and 1.21.x before 1.21.8, and 1.22.x before 1.22.5 does not properly handle a correctly authenticated but unintended login attempt, which makes it easier for remote authenticated users to obtain sensitive information by arranging for a victim to login to the attacker's account, as demonstrated by tracking the victim's activity, related to a "login CSRF" issue. | ||||
